Output dd7b6b85f53a1038c1e19a4bd77162837025bc364ce50d19fd1376887558e119:2

value
36012862
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b6dd4d93a79757f2b7fc260750e736023c50387b OP_EQUAL
address
MQa4KkKZP7fBbRPzbULgnfSXiQY8u2EKWV
transaction
dd7b6b85f53a1038c1e19a4bd77162837025bc364ce50d19fd1376887558e119
spent
true